Abstract
A catheter for use in neurosurgery, and a method of positioning neurosurgical apparatus. The catheter has a fine tube arranged for insertion into the brain parenchyma of a patient with an external diameter of not more than 1.0 mm. The catheter and method may be used in stereotactically targeting treatment of abnormalities of brain function, and for the infusion of therapeutic agents directly into the brain parenchyma. This is advantageous when a therapeutic agent would have widespread unwanted effects which could be avoided by confining the delivery to the malfunctioning or damaged brain tissue.

2. A method of accurately positioning a catheter at a desired target location in the brain parenchyma of a patient, comprising:
-
fixedly securing a hub device to a single fine tube neurosurgical catheter in a manner that the hub device is non-movable with respect to the single fine tube neurosurgical catheter, the single fine tube neurosurgical catheter having an external diameter of 0.7 mm or less; inserting a neurosurgical guide into the brain toward the desired target location, the neurosurgical guide including a guide tube having distal and proximal ends, stopping the inserting of the neurosurgical guide when the distal end of the guide tube falls short of the desired target by between 5 and 20 mm; securing a head assembly to the neurosurgical guide at or in contact with the proximal end of the guide tube, the head assembly having an opening; inserting the single fine tube neurosurgical catheter through the opening in the head assembly and through the guide tube; advancing the single fine tube neurosurgical catheter such that a distal end of the single fine tube neurosurgical catheter is advanced past the distal end of the guide tube toward the desired target; and abutting the hub device against the head assembly to accurately locate the distal end of the single fine tube neurosurgical catheter at the desired target.
